A convenient feces and urine sample sampling and temporary storage device
By designing a convenient temporary storage device for fecal and urine specimens, and using a support and clip structure to stabilize the fecal and urine cup, the problem of spillage during storage is solved, achieving stable storage and preventing confusion, making it suitable for single use.

T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The application belongs to the technical field of sampling devices, and particularly relates to a convenient feces and urine sample sampling and temporary storage device. BACKGROUND
[0002] Collecting and testing feces and urine is a routine examination method in hospitals. Feces testing can help understand whether the digestive tract is infected by bacteria, viruses and parasites, and help discover gastrointestinal inflammation and liver disease as soon as possible. Feces testing can also be used for screening and diagnosis of digestive tract tumors. Urine testing includes routine analysis, detection of formed elements (such as red blood cells and white blood cells) in urine, quantitative determination of protein components, and determination of urine enzymes. Urine testing has a very important value for clinical diagnosis, judgment of curative effect and prognosis. Before examination, feces and urine samples of patients must be collected, and the collection process is usually completed by the patients themselves.
[0003] When collecting feces, a feces cup is used, and when collecting urine, a urine testing cup is used. After the collection is completed, the patient may accidentally or due to hand shaking cause the cup to be unstable and spill the collected feces and urine samples when changing clothes. After the collection is completed, the patient usually stores the feces and urine samples in a designated position by himself, and then the medical staff collects the samples. However, since the feces cup and the urine testing cup are usually small and light, and in order to facilitate the storage of feces and urine, they are usually designed to be large at the top and small at the bottom, which is very unstable in center of gravity. This causes the patient to place the cup unstable and cause the feces and urine samples to spill, or the next patient to knock over the samples placed by the previous patient and cause the samples to spill. SUMMARY
[0004] The application aims to provide a convenient feces and urine sample sampling and temporary storage device to solve the problem that the cup of the collected feces and urine samples is easy to spill when stored.
[0005] In order to achieve the above purpose, the application provides a convenient feces and urine sample sampling and temporary storage device, which includes two supports, the supports are arranged in parallel, an upper clamping piece and a lower clamping piece are arranged between the supports, the upper clamping piece and the lower clamping piece are connected to the two ends of the supports on both sides, the upper clamping piece and the lower clamping piece are both double-layer structures in the thickness direction, a connecting belt is arranged on each of the inner side edges of the two supports, and a connecting structure is arranged on the connecting belt, which makes the length of the two connecting belts together less than the length of the lower clamping piece.
[0006] The working principle and beneficial effects of the application are as follows:
[0007] The entire structure is in the form of a sheet when not in use, which is very convenient to carry.
[0008] When the cup body collecting the feces and urine sample needs to be stored, the outer sides of the two supports are held by two fingers of one hand, and then pinched gently inward. The double-layer structure of the upper clamping piece and the lower clamping piece is stressed and then arches outward (if necessary, the remaining fingers can be used to control the arching direction), so that the upper clamping piece and the lower clamping piece are respectively enclosed into a ring shape. After the distance between the supports is reduced, the connecting belts can be connected together through the connecting structure. Since the length of the two connecting belts as a whole after being connected together is less than the length of the lower clamping piece, the upper clamping piece and the lower clamping piece can remain arched. Therefore, the stool cup and the urine testing cup can be clamped into the upper clamping piece and the lower clamping piece, respectively. When the entire device is stored on any plane, the lower edge of the entire lower clamping piece is in contact with the plane. The area enclosed by the lower edge is larger than the area of the bottom of the cup body, so that the storage is more stable, and the cup body with the collected feces and urine sample is less likely to spill after being stored.
[0009] After the connecting belts are connected, they can form a blocking effect on the cup mouth of the cup body stored in the lower clamping piece, so that the cup body stored on the lower clamping piece is more stable and less likely to spill. The bottom of the cup body stored in the upper clamping piece can also fall on the connecting belts, which is convenient for storing a cup body with a deeper depth on the upper clamping piece, and the cup body in the upper clamping piece and the cup body in the lower clamping piece can be separated by the connecting belts.
[0010] When the stool cup and the urine testing cup of one patient need to be stored at the same time, the two sample cups of the patient can be stored on the same temporary storage device, which avoids the confusion of samples of different patients by medical staff.
[0011] When only one cup body needs to be stored (either only the stool test is completed or only the urine test is completed), the cup body with the collected sample is only stored in the lower clamping piece, and the upper clamping piece can be used as a handle, which makes the operation more convenient and avoids spilling during the transfer of the cup body.
[0012] The entire structure is simple, and the cost is simple. Common hard paper, plastic sheet and other materials can be used to make it, and the cost is extremely low. It is very beneficial to make disposable products, and thus it is very beneficial to popularize and apply.
[0013] Optionally, the support, the upper clamping piece, the lower clamping piece and the connecting belts are integrally formed. The entire structure is simpler, and it is more convenient to cut and make from double-layered hard paperboard.
[0014] Optionally, the upper clamping piece and the lower clamping piece are both provided with inserts at both ends, and the inner side of the support is provided with insertion slots corresponding to the upper clamping piece and the lower clamping piece. The inserts are inserted into the insertion slots.
[0015] Optionally, the upper clamping piece and the lower clamping piece are both provided with clamping grooves at both ends, and the inner side of the support is clamped in the clamping grooves.
[0016] Optionally, the distance between the connecting band and the upper side of the lower clamping piece is smaller than the distance between the connecting band and the lower side of the upper clamping piece. The closer distance between the connecting band and the lower clamping piece can provide more space for the upper clamping piece to place the cup and can also facilitate the blocking of the cup opening of the cup placed in the lower clamping piece.
[0017] Optionally, the upper clamping piece and the lower clamping piece are provided with fold lines. The upper clamping piece and the lower clamping piece can be arched into a polygon along the fold lines during the arching process, and after being placed in the circular cup, the upper clamping piece and the lower clamping piece can better wrap the cup to make the cup more stable on the temporary storage device.
[0018] Optionally, the temporary storage device further comprises a stabilizing wing, one end of the stabilizing wing is connected to the outer side of the lower clamping piece, and the lower side of the stabilizing wing is flush with the lower side of the lower clamping piece. The stabilizing wing can increase the contact area between the lower clamping piece and the placement plane, making the temporary storage device more stable.
[0019] Optionally, a connecting hole is formed in one of the connecting bands, and a connecting pin is formed in the other connecting band to match the connecting hole. The connecting pin is inserted into the connecting hole to connect the two connecting bands in a snap-fit manner.
[0020] Optionally, the end of one of the connecting bands is attached with double-sided tape.

[0029] The following detailed description illustrates the specific implementation method:
[0030] The markings in the accompanying drawings include: bracket 1, horizontal end 101, vertical end 102, connecting strap 2, double-sided adhesive 3, connecting pin 4, connecting hole 5, upper clamping piece 6, lower clamping piece 7, dent 8, slot 9, separation piece 10, rectangular hole 11, and stabilizing wing 12.
[0031] Example 1
[0032] This embodiment presents a convenient fecal and urine specimen sampling and storage device. The entire device is made by overlapping and cutting two rectangular pieces of cardboard. The rectangular cardboard measures 8cm × 10cm × 0.1cm. After the cardboard pieces are aligned and stacked together, their long sides are glued together with a glue width of 1cm. Then, a rectangular hole of 6cm × 2.5cm and a rectangular hole of 6cm × 0.5cm are cut into the cardboard. The long sides of the two rectangular holes are parallel to the wide sides of the cardboard, and the distance between the two rectangular holes is 0.5cm. The distance from each side of the rectangular hole to the long side of the cardboard is 1cm. This forms a 2cm wide upper clip and a 4cm wide lower clip on both sides of the wide side of the cardboard, and the glued cardboard portion forms a support. The cardboard portion located between the two rectangular holes is cut in the middle to form two connecting straps. Double-sided tape is attached to the outer side of one of the connecting straps. Insert two wires 2cm apart between the upper and lower clips, and 4cm away from the long sides of the cardboard. Press firmly on the cardboard sections with the wires inserted; this will create two parallel indentations on the inner sides of the upper and lower clips, forming fold lines. A schematic diagram of the entire temporary storage device before use is attached. Figure 1 As shown.
[0033] Due to the presence of indentations within the upper and lower clips, as shown in the attached... Figure 2 When pinching the supports on both sides as shown, both the upper and lower clips tend to arch outwards. Slightly pinching inwards will allow them to arch into a regular hexagon. At this point, the free ends of the two connecting straps overlap, allowing them to be glued together with double-sided tape. After gluing, the upper and lower clips will maintain their hexagonal shape, as shown in the attached diagram. Figure 3 As shown, the stool cup and urine cup can be inserted into the hexagon for temporary storage. The cup body and the mouth of the cup usually have an outwardly extending edge that can abut against the upper edge of the upper and lower clips, which can prevent the cup body from sliding down in the temporary storage device.
[0034] Example Two
[0035] The difference between this example and Example One is that, as shown in Figure 4 the figure, the dents are pressed on the outside of the upper and lower clamping pieces with iron wires. In this way, the iron wires do not need to be inserted between the cardboard during processing, and the processing is easier. When cutting the rectangular hole near the upper clamping piece, two semicircular notches are reserved on the side near the upper clamping piece, and the two notches are staggered, thereby forming two separate pieces integrally on the lower side of the upper clamping piece. When pinching the support, two fingers of the other hand are respectively placed on the two separate pieces and slightly force the two outer sides of the upper clamping piece, so that the upper clamping piece has a tendency to arch outward. Since the entire structure is integral, the lower clamping piece also has a tendency to arch outward. By continuing to pinch inward, the upper and lower clamping pieces can be arched into a hexagon.
[0036] Example Three
[0037] The difference between this example and Example One is that it also includes stabilizing wings. The stabilizing wings are made of the material cut when cutting a larger rectangular hole, and the two layers of the cardboard are separated, i.e., two stabilizing wings. Then the two stabilizing wings are respectively arranged on the two sides of the lower clamping piece. One end of the stabilizing wing is bonded to the outer side of the lower clamping piece, and the lower side of the stabilizing wing is flush with the lower side of the lower clamping piece. When in use, the stabilizing wings are folded outward, as shown in Figure 5 the figure, which can increase the lateral contact area of the entire device, thereby allowing the entire temporary storage device to be placed more stably.
[0038] Example Four
[0039] A convenient feces and urine sample sampling and temporary storage device in this example, as shown in Figure 6As shown, each bracket is made of two pieces of T-shaped cardboard, but the two ends of the bracket are not bonded, leaving a 2 cm and 4 cm gap respectively, which forms the insertion slot, and the vertical end of the bracket is the connecting band. The end of one connecting band is punched with a round connecting hole, and the end of the other connecting band is bonded with a cylindrical connecting pin, and the insertion slot is located on both sides of the connecting band. The number of brackets is two. The upper clamping piece is composed of two pieces of 8 cm x 2 cm x 0.05 cm flexible transparent plastic sheet, and the two ends are bonded for 1 cm, which forms the insertion piece inserted into the 2 cm wide insertion slot of the bracket. The lower clamping piece is the same as the lower clamping piece in material, structure and manufacturing method, except that the width of the lower clamping piece is 4 cm, and the two ends of the upper clamping piece are inserted into the 4 cm insertion slot. Compared with Example One, the upper clamping piece and the lower clamping piece can be made of transparent material, which is convenient for the inspector to see the substance contained in the cup through the upper clamping piece and the lower clamping piece, and it is convenient to distinguish directly before the cup is taken out, which improves the work efficiency of the inspector. The form of the connecting pin and the connecting hole is connected, which is better than using double-sided adhesive to connect, has good repeatability, makes the whole temporary storage device reusable, and is easier to open the connecting band and take out the cup in the lower clamping piece.
[0040] Example Five
[0041] A convenient fecal and urine specimen sampling and temporary storage device is provided in this embodiment, as shown in Figure 7 As shown, the number of brackets is two, and each bracket is composed of a piece of T-shaped cardboard. The vertical end of the bracket is the connecting band, and the end of one connecting band is pasted with double-sided adhesive. The upper clamping piece is composed of two pieces of 6 cm x 2 cm x 0.03 cm flexible transparent plastic sheet, and the two ends are bonded to the bottom edge of a clamping groove, and the two sides of the clamping groove are concave inward and abut. The clamping groove is made of iron sheet. The lower clamping piece is the same as the lower clamping piece in material, structure and manufacturing method, except that the width of the lower clamping piece is 4 cm. The vertical ends of the two brackets are arranged opposite to each other, and the clamping grooves on both sides of the upper clamping piece and the lower clamping piece are clamped to the two ends of the horizontal end of the bracket. Compared with Example Four, the structure of this embodiment is simpler and more convenient to process.
